About The Faculty of Biosciences The Faculty of Biosciences (BIOVIT) is dedicated to generating knowledge that supports a sustainable future for food systems and bioproduction, with a strong focus on biology, animal- and plant sciences and aquaculture. We have a large portfolio of basic and applied research projects supported by state-of-the-art facilities and research infrastructure. Our 200 staff members and 600 students, including 80 PhDs, undertake a range of projects and courses that are closely integrated with our research. In this thriving environment, we educate and train the next generation experts to solve current and future societal challenges connected to food production and climate change The Research Group The successful candidate will join the Genome Biology research group possessing expertise in genetics, evolutionary and comparative genomics, bioinformatics and systems biology. Located within the Department of Animal- and Aquacultural Sciences, this group includes 4 full-time professors, 11 researchers, 2 postdocs and 2 PhD students and 7 research technicians. The research group (www.cigene.no) has a strong track record in both basic and applied research. Our applied research focuses on aquatic and agricultural species, utilizing genetics, ‘omics’, cell biology, and gene editing technologies to understand how genomic variation is linked to trait variation. The group’s basic research portfolio addresses fundamental principles of genome function and evolution, including karyotype evolution, gene regulation, three-dimensional genome organization, and the consequences of polyploidy. The Genome Biology research group is also closely linked with the CIGENE lab, which offers excellent wet lab facilities for automated high-throughput omics technologies and experimental cell biology
Postdoctoral position in Plant Evolutionary Genomics and Pangenomics Department of Plant Biology About the position A postdoctoral position in plant evolutionary genomics is available in the Yant Lab at the Swedish University of Agricultural Sciences (SLU) in Uppsala, Sweden. The Yant Lab develops computational and genomic approaches to understand evolution, adaptation, genome dynamics, and whole-genome duplication across diverse plant systems (see https://www.yantlab.net/). The project is funded through a Formas grant aimed at restoring European ash (Fraxinus excelsior) populations threatened by ash dieback. The successful candidate will contribute to developing the first Swedish-focused European ash pangenome, integrating long-read genome assemblies with population-scale sequencing to understand disease resistance and local adaptation across Europe. The project combines large-scale population genomics, graph-based pangenomics, structural variant discovery, genome-wide association studies, and evolutionary genomics using state-of-the-art long-read sequencing and computational genomic approaches. The successful candidate will work closely with collaborators at other SLU campuses, the Royal Botanic Gardens, Kew, and other European partners, contributing to both methodological developments and biological discovery. The project offers an opportunity to work at the forefront of plant evolutionary genomics while contributing directly to forest restoration and conservation. About us The Department of Plant Biology (www.slu.se/en/vbsg) offers a creative and stimulating international environment and is one of several departments that make up the ‘Uppsala BioCenter’. The department undertakes fundamental research on model organisms, agricultural crops, forest trees and bioenergy crops. Our main areas of research comprise the interaction of plants with microorganisms and other environmental stresses, plant growth and development, biotechnology and metabolic engineering, regulation of gene expression, population genetics, genome analysis, and the development of breeding systems. Species in use are model organisms such as the entire Arabidopsis genus, Physcomitrella, Cochlearia, crops such as rapeseed, basket willow (Salix), potato, and cereals, and pathogens such as viruses, bacteria, and fungi/oomycetes. The department is responsible for basic and advanced courses in general and molecular genetics, cell biology, gene technology, plant physiology, plant breeding, plant biochemistry and biotechnology, and molecular interactions between plants and pathogens.
